Between 1845 and 1849, Edward McGaughey ran in 2 U.S. House elections, winning all 2. McGaughey's biggest single-election total was 6,782 votes, in the 1849 U.S. House election in Indiana's District 7. McGaughey's closest win came in the 1845 U.S. House election in Indiana's District 7, decided by 169 votes.
